Perth Plants provides a comprehensive photographic guide to all plants known to occur in the bushlands of Kings Park and Bold Park. There are 778 species included--both natural and introduced--representing approximately one quarter of all the plants in the greater Perth region, and one-tenth of all species known for the south-west of Western Australia.
This second edition of this field guide contains 22 additional species and updated photography throughout.
Features:
* This is one of the most detailed field guides available for south-west Western Australia, with species presented in their most current scientific classification.
* With multiple photos per species, the book provides a relatively easy means of identifying both native and naturalized species in the Perth region and beyond.
* Small enough to fit in a backpack for field use, but detailed enough to provide a solid identification tool, this is a very practical field guide.

Russell L. Barrett has worked as a Research Botanist with the Botanic Gardens, the Australian National Herbarium and CSIRO. He is an Adjunct Lecturer at the University of Western Australia and a research Associate at the Western Australian Herbarium.
Eng Pin Tay is a Herbarium Botanist at the Botanic Gardens and Parks Authority, Perth. He has previously worked with tropical plants in Singapore as Curator of the then Parks & Recreation Department and as a Senior Research officer at the Singapore Botanic Gardens. His work as taken him to many natural areas in South-East Asia and botanic gardens around the world.
